Which side of the plane should I sit on flying from Indira Gandhi International (DEL) to Manohar International Airport (GOX)?

Sit on the Left side of the plane for the best views on flights from Delhi to Mopa. While takeoff favors the right, the landing approach on the left provides more dramatic and sustained scenic value. The Western Ghats and Mandomi River valley during descent offer more visually distinctive features than the relatively flat Delhi departure.

What can I see during takeoff from Indira Gandhi International in Delhi?

During takeoff from Indira Gandhi International (DEL), sit on the Right side for the best views. Right-side seats capture the Yamuna River winding through Delhi's eastern districts and the Aravalli Hills rising to the south and southeast. The aircraft climbs southwestward, so right windows show the terrain the plane is ascending over. Notable sights include: Yamuna River (visible as a ribbon through urban sprawl), Aravalli Hills (low mountain range to the southeast), Delhi's urban grid (Noida and Ghaziabad districts to the east), Indira Gandhi International Airport complex itself receding below.

What can I see when landing at Manohar International Airport in Mopa?

When landing at Manohar International Airport (GOX), sit on the Left side for the best views. Left-side seats offer views of the Western Ghats and the Sahyadri mountain range as the aircraft descends toward Mopa. The approach path from the northeast means left windows face the dramatic escarpment and forested terrain that defines this region. Notable sights include: Western Ghats/Sahyadri Range (steep mountain escarpment), Mandovi River valley (visible as a green corridor), Laterite plateaus and forested slopes, Mopa airfield and surrounding Goa landscape.

How long is the flight from Delhi to Mopa?

The flight from Indira Gandhi International (DEL) to Manohar International Airport (GOX) takes Approximately 2 hours 15 minutes to 2 hours 45 minutes.

What does the Delhi to Mopa flight path pass over?

The flight path crosses the Deccan Plateau, passing over central India's landscape. Notable features include the Narmada River valley (visible around the midpoint, running east-west), the transition from the Indo-Gangetic Plain to the Deccan Plateau terrain, and scattered towns and agricultural fields across Maharashtra. The Western Ghats become increasingly prominent as the aircraft approaches Goa, with the escarpment rising from roughly 2,000 feet elevation to over 4,000 feet.
